Premium gushu material from the most famous village in puer, subjected to careful wo dui fermentation. Proof that shou can be as terroir-expressive as sheng when the raw material and craft are uncompromising.

Origin
Lao Ban Zhang, Bulang Shan, Menghai, Yunnan, China
Land
1,600-1,900m
Craft
Spring harvest. Hand-picked gushu maocha, wo dui pile fermentation (moderate level to preserve origin character), compressed.
